Jump to navigationJump to searchEdwin Johnson was a private in the 24th Michigan Infantry / Company G.
Antebellum
War Career
- Enlisted on August 7, 1862 in the 24th Michigan Infantry / Company G at Detroit, Michigan
- Mustered in August 13, 1862 for a 3 year term of service
- 23 years old
- Died of Disease at Fort Schuyler, New York on August 29, 1864
- Buried in Cypress Hill Cemetery, Long Island New York
- Grave number 1765
